Qiagen announces takeover of Enzymatics’ enzyme solutions unit
Qiagen has agreed to purchase the enzyme solutions business of Enzymatics, a leading provider of enzymes for use in next-generation sequencing applications.
These enzymes are key ingredients across the workflows of all commercially available sequencing solutions, with Enzymatics products used in 80 percent of all global next-generation sequencing reactions.
This portfolio will be commercialised globally through Qiagen's direct, indirect and original equipment manufacturing channels. The deal sees Qiagen take control of all assets relating to the business, including research and development, manufacturing, formulation and analytical capabilities.
Peer Schatz, chief executive officer of Qiagen, said: "We are committed to supporting the global sequencing community through continued access to the solutions and products from Enzymatics' world-class capabilities."
